Responding to a Parking Citation

Parking Meter

A Metro parking citation is written for the violation of a Metro Parking Ordinance and may be written by six different enforcement agencies in Davidson County. These enforcement agencies are as follows:

  • Metropolitan Police Department
  • Park Police
  • Airport Authority
  • Public Works Traffic Enforcement
  • Vanderbilt Police
  • Metro Property Guards

How To Satisfy Your Metro Parking Citation

All Metro parking citations contain an Issuance Date, which is the date that the citation was written. Violators are given forty-five (45) calendar days from this date to pay their citations or thirty (30) calendar days to plead not guilty and request a court date.

The citation must be satisfied by this “Compliance Date” in order to avoid the imposition of additional fees and referral to the Traffic Warrant Division for collection by parking warrant, wage garnishment or levy of property. For instructions on calculating your compliance date, click here.

In order to satisfy a parking citation, the offender must take one of the following two possible actions:

  1. Plead guilty and pay a fine;
  2. Plead not guilty and request a court hearing date.
